Britain has its own subspecies of red squirrel (left). Known as Sciurus vulgaris leucourus, it was first described by Scottish-born surgeon and science writer Robert Kerr in 1792. It is considered uniquely different based on a blanching (whitening) of the tail during the summer months. The continental European relative of our red, Sciurus vulgaris vulgaris, has a much darker tail. Red squirrels have been in Britain for around 10,000 years, since the last ice age.
